1. Leverage Social Media Campaigns
Social media is a powerful tool for reaching potential donors and increasing visibility:
- Create Compelling Content: Share stories, videos, and images that resonate emotionally with your audience.
- Utilize Live Streaming: Host live events and Q&A sessions to engage with followers in real time.
- Run Targeted Ads: Use platforms like Facebook and Instagram to reach specific demographics interested in your cause.
2. Organize Community Events
Engaging with the community is a great way to build relationships and raise funds:
- Host Fundraising Events: Organize community gatherings like charity runs, auctions, or benefit dinners.
- Collaborate with Local Businesses: Partner with local businesses for sponsorships or to donate a portion of sales on specific days.
- Volunteer Lead Initiatives: Encourage community members to host their own fundraising events and support your cause.
3. Explore Grant Opportunities
Many organizations in South Africa offer grants to nonprofits:
- Research Potential Grants: Identify foundations and government programs that fund initiatives aligned with your mission.
- Develop Grant Proposals: Craft well-researched proposals that clearly outline your organization's goals and impact.
- Follow Up: Maintain communication with grantors and provide updates on your projects and outcomes.
4. Implement Peer-to-Peer Fundraising
Empower your supporters to fundraise on your behalf:
- Provide Tools and Templates: Equip your volunteers with necessary materials for their fundraising efforts.
- Incentivize Participation: Offer rewards or recognition for top fundraisers to encourage participation.
- Set Clear Goals: Help participants understand the impact of reaching their goals for your organization.
5. Establish a Recurring Donation Program
Monthly contributions can stabilize cash flow for nonprofits:
- Promote Monthly Giving: Regular contributions can significantly enhance your fundraising results.
- Share Impact Stories: Regularly update your donors on how their contributions are making a difference.
- Make It Easy: Streamline the donation process with a user-friendly online platform for recurring gifts.
